Activity itinerary

Montmartre

Dozens of cobblestone streets, sumptuous hidden mansions, Parisian cafés, charming terraces everywhere… No mistake you are in Montmartre ! You have probably heard of Montmartre as the residency of some famous painters of the 19th and 20th century, but it has also a great gastronomical heritage as cakes, chocolate sweets, generous cheeses, cured meats and French wine! On the way, your local & foodie guide will take you to the breathtaking Clos des Vignes, which happens to be the only vineyard in Paris. He will walk you down these streets in order to introduce you to the best food artisans of the area, and also to share with you some unforgettable tastings at every stop. You'll feel like a little child while eating the sweet treats we've selected, while a glass of good wine paired with some fresh cheeses & cured meat will make you feel in the shoes of a real Parisian enjoying an apéritif with friends! Le Bateau-Lavoir (Pass by)

Famous in art history as the residence and meeting place for a group of outstanding early 20th-century artists such as Pablo Picasso, men of letters, theatre people, and art dealers.

Le Mur des Je t'aime

  • 5m
The Wall of Love of Paris. The wall includes the words 'I love you' in all major languages, but also in rarer ones like Navajo, Inuit, Bambara and Esperanto.

Place du Tertre

  • 10m
Montmartre village central square, known also as the "Artists' corner" of Montmartre and Paris.

Basilique du Sacre-Coeur de Montmartre (Pass by)

The tour finishes front of le Sacré-Coeur, with the best view in town.

Le Moulin de la Galette (Pass by)

An early 17th-century windmill. A masterpiece of the local history in Montmartre.
